The neighborhood I choose to observe was the Castle Gate Circle, Lisa Lane neighborhood. (See Figure 1) The start point was a house at the beginning of Castle Gate Circle, which is located in a single family neighborhood built in 1988. I walk down Castle Gate Circle in the middle of the street because they are no sidewalks and there are cars along the curbside. The first thing I notice is that most of the driveways are only one car driveways. This is because it is a single family zoned neighborhood. The other driveways that were not one car driveways were modified in to a two car driveway. I continue my observation and see that there are some basketball goals up, which to me indicates that there is not a high value of traffic that goes through this neighborhood. I see that all of the yards in this neighborhood are neat in appearance. This might be because of a neighborhood ordinance.
